SPONSORED: Alaska’s largest marathon is a scenic tour of Anchorage and an iconic part of the state’s sports history.
Every year thousands of people celebrate summer solstice by taking part in the Anchorage Mayor’s Marathon, one of Alaska’s premier races welcoming runners from across the nation and world.
“Every marathon is an odyssey and everyone who does it has a story of their own race,” said Anchorage resident Jim Renkert.Renkert is a local history buff. He completed the marathon several times as a teenager in the 1970s. The event is a partnership between the Municipality of Anchorage Parks and Recreation Department and the University of Alaska Anchorage Athletics Department. Proceeds from the race support maintenance and improvement of city parks and student athletes at UAA.
